WET PAINT

Wet Paint is an exciting art event and auction of original works of art created over two days. at outdoor sites throughout Collier County. The public will be encouraged to participate by viewing the artists on site as they work and then to bid on the art at auction.

This unusual event will benefit the Collier County Mental Health Foundation, which is dedicated to building an endowment for the long-term financial stability of the Mental Health Association of Collier County.

For the past four years, the Mental Health Association of Collier County has sponsored the fundraising event known as Wet Paint SM to benefit the Mental Health Association of Collier County, and increase public awareness and participation in the visual arts. The dates for the 2006 event will be on-site painting from 10 a.m. until 3:00 p.m on Thursday, February 9th and Friday, February 10th. Artists are scheduled to turn in their completed, framed artwork between 1 – 4 p.m. on Saturday, February 11th.

The gala auction event will take place at the Clubhouse of Aston Gardens in Pelican Marsh on Sunday, February 12th . Cocktails will be served, attendees will have an opportunity to preview the auction art and a silent auction (of art objects of a non-competitive nature to the live auction art) will take place from 4 – 6:30 p.m. A sit-down buffet dinner will be served with the live auction starting immediately after dinner.
